Marty Perez had 4 hits at Fulton Co. Stadium as the Atlanta Braves beat the
Pittsburgh Pirates by the count of 5 to 3.
Atlanta tallied 2 runs in the bottom of the 3rd inning when they had 3 base
hits. Perez started the inning off right when he slapped a single. After an
out was recorded, Hank Aaron stepped up to the plate and he drew a walk.
Billy Williams then laced a single plating a run. One out later, Gary
Sutherland came to the plate and laced a base-hit scoring the final run of
the inning. Pittsburgh made it exciting in the 9th, but they were unable to
push the needed runs across.
Ron Schueler(4-6) got the win allowing 3 runs in 6 and 2/3 innings. Cecil
Upshaw earned the save, his 15th. Jim Merritt(0-4) ended up with the loss.
He allowed a few too many baserunners giving up 8 hits and 2 walks in 4
innings.

Al Oliver went deep and had 2 RBI and Ken Brett pitched a complete game at
Fulton Co. Stadium as the Pittsburgh Pirates beat the Atlanta Braves by the
count of 8 to 1.
Pittsburgh took the lead off Eddie Fisher in the first inning scoring one
runner using 2 hits. Tommy McCraw doubled. Freddie Patek stepped up to the
plate and he laid down a sacrifice bunt. Oliver then doubled scoring the
run. Pittsburgh had 12 hits for the night.
Brett(6-11) allowed 1 run on the game. Fisher(3-2) suffered the loss. He
allowed Pittsburgh 6 runs in 5 innings of work.

Richie Hebner jacked one out of the ballyard and had 4 RBI as the Pittsburgh
Pirates beat the Atlanta Braves by a score of 12 to 7.
Hebner had a big day with his bat. He doubled in the 2nd inning, doubled
plating a run in the 5th inning and lofted a three-run bomb (his 12th of the
season) in the 8th inning. For the game Pittsburgh out-hit Atlanta 17 to 13.
Dock Ellis(12-5) went 7 innings allowing 5 runs for the win. Tom
Timmerman(1-10) was given the loss. He gave up 10 hits and no walks in 6
innings.
